Being an awesome sibling is about more than just sharing a genetic bond with your brothers and sisters. It's about building strong, positive relationships with them, supporting each other through thick and thin, and creating lasting memories together. Here are some tips on how to be an awesome sibling: 1. Show love and appreciation: Make it a habit to tell your siblings that you love and appreciate them. Express your gratitude for the things they do for you, even if it's just something small. 2. Be supportive: Be there for your siblings when they need you. Whether it's helping them with a problem, offering a shoulder to cry on, or just being a listening ear, your support can make a big difference. 3. Respect their boundaries: Everyone has their own boundaries, and it's important to respect them. If your sibling doesn't want to talk about something, give them space and time. Don't push them to share if they're not ready. 4. Have fun together: Spend time doing things you both enjoy. Whether it's playing video games, watching a movie, or going for a walk, find activities that bring you closer together. 5. Be a good listener: When your siblings talk to you, give them your full attention. Listen to what they're saying without interrupting, and show that you're interested in what they have to say. 6. Apologize when you're wrong: No one is perfect, and everyone makes mistakes. If you do something wrong or hurtful, apologize and try to make things right. Acknowledge your mistakes and learn from them. 7. Celebrate their successes: When your siblings achieve something, celebrate their successes with them. Whether it's getting good grades, landing a new job, or winning an award, show your support and encouragement. 8. Be dependable: Be someone your siblings can count on. If you say you're going to do something, follow through. Be reliable and trustworthy, and your siblings will know they can always count on you. 9. Give them space: While it's important to spend time together, it's also important to respect each other's need for space. If your sibling needs some alone time, give it to them without making them feel guilty. 10. Be patient: Sibling relationships can be complex, and it's important to be patient with each other. Remember that everyone has their own journey, and try to be understanding when your sibling is going through a tough time. By following these tips, you can build strong, positive relationships with your siblings and become an awesome sibling yourself.
